Olga Borisovna Meganskaya (Russian: Ольга Борисовна Меганская; born: 6 March 1992) is a Russian singer, model and former member of Ukrainian girl group Nu Virgos.

Life and career[]

Meganskaya[1] was born on 6 March 1992 in Yaroslavl.[2] In parallel with her studies at the elementary school, Meganskaya took piano and solo classes, and after receiving her diploma, she was admitted to the Saint Petersburg State University to the Faculty of "Musical Art of the House of Music".[3] Meganskaya[4] took part in numerous vocal contests and more than once had won.[5] Meganskaya started her career as a singer by singing in restaurants and bars, at festivals and other events.[6] She took part in the "slipstream" auditions of the 6th season of the popular musical project The Voice in the Summer of 2017, but none of the coaches turn their backs.[7]

2018–2020: Nu Virgos[]

In March 2018, through a private casting she replaced Misha Romanova in Nu Virgos.[8][9] Nu Virgos released three official singles with Meganskaya as part of the group "Я Полюбила Монстра"[10] (I Was In Love With A Monster), "ЛюбоЛь"[11] (LovePain) and "1+1". On 16 October 2020, Meganskaya announced that she is leaving the group.[12]

2021–present[]

After her departure from Nu Virgos, Meganskaya started working as a model and singing at private events. In April 2022 Meganskaya posted on her Instagram account, that she signed a contract with a worldwide model agency.[13] On August 22, Meganskaya announced her debut solo concert in Saint-Petersburg that was scheduled for August 27[14]
